Grant was an undergraduate and DPhil student at Trinity College, Oxford. He then became a Junior Research Fellow at St. John's College, Oxford, before winning a prestigious Royal Society Fellowship. He is now Professor of Chemistry and the John and Patricia Danby Tutorial Fellow in Chemistry at Worcester College. Grant is also the head of section for Physical and Theoretical Chemistry. Teaching
Grant teaches all aspects of the Physical Chemistry course to undergraduates at Worcester College, Oxford. He also lectures to all undergraduate chemists on Quantum Mechanics and Atmospheric Chemistry.
